Why aluminum

Nowadays, more emphasis is placed on heating due to its functionality and aesthetics. Highest quality is required to ensure comfort, energy savings and environmental friendliness. Aluminum has been used for one hundred years. Modern technologies can turn aluminum into functional and modern shapes.

Aluminum is very good heat conductor. Its conductivity is 3 times greater than iron and is resistant to pressure. It is ideal for both heating and cooling systems.

Aluminum radiators heat even at low temperature gradients with great speed and efficiency. As a result, they are used to save energy.

Comparison of aluminum, steel and cast iron radiators

  • Less water
    – Aluminum radiators require significantly less water to achieve the same heat output as steel and cast iron radiators
  • Save heating time
    – Aluminum is an ideal material for heat transfer due to its physical properties.
  • Less space
    – Aluminum profiles can be used to produce radiators of various lengths and widths in very interesting shapes. Radiators will no longer be boring in shape and become one of the main aesthetic elements in your interior.
  • Lower weight
    – Main advantages of aluminum is its low weight – it is up to 3 times lighter than steel. Very light radiators ensure easy handling and installation.
  • Temperature flexibility
    – Due to their low weight and less water, aluminum radiators can reach high temperatures in a short time, increasing heating comfort.
